Request (Noun and Verb)

<A-1,Noun,155,aitema> denotes "that which has been asked for" (akin to aiteo, "to ask"); in Luke 23:24, RV, "what they asked for" (AV, "as they required"), lit., "their request (should be done, ginomai);" in Phil. 4:6, "requests;" in 1 John 5:15, "petitions." See PETITION, REQUIRE.
<A-2,Noun,1162,deesis> "an asking, entreaty, supplication," is translated "request" in Phil. 1:4, AV (RV, "supplication"). See PRAYER, SUPPLICATION.
<B-1,Verb,1189,deomai> akin to A, No. 2, "to beseech, pray, request," is translated "to make request" in Rom. 1:10. See BESEECH, No. 3.
<B-2,Verb,154,aiteo> "to ask," is translated "to make request" in Col. 1:9, RV (AV, "to desire"). See ASK, No. 1.
<B-3,Verb,2065,erotao> "to ask," is translated "to make request" in 1 John 5:16. See ASK, No. 2 and remarks on the difference between Nos. 1 and 2.
